Abstract
We perform first principles quantum simulations of atomic four-wave mixing via a collision of two Bose-Einstein condensates of metastable helium atoms. We analyse the collinear and back-to-back pair correlations of atoms on the s-wave scattering halo. The results provide qualitative and quantitative understanding of the recent experiments at Orsay [A. Perrin et al., arXiv: 0704.3047].
